Jammu and Kashmir Bank LINK ROAD JAMMU IFSC Code

The LINK ROAD JAMMU branch of Jammu and Kashmir Bank located in JAMMU, JAMMU AND KASHMIR is identified by the IFSC code JAKA0LINKRO. This 11-character code is issued by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) and is required for electronic fund transfers such as NEFT, RTGS, IMPS and UPI.

How to transfer money using JAKA0LINKRO

  1. Log in to your bank’s net banking or mobile banking app.
  2. Choose the NEFT, RTGS or IMPS transfer option.
  3. Add the beneficiary with account number and branch name.
  4. Enter IFSC code JAKA0LINKRO to identify the LINK ROAD JAMMU branch.
  5. Enter the amount and confirm the transaction.
